A.J Walter Aviation increased its Airbus and Boeing component inventory at its facilities in Miami and Los Angeles. The company is building up its inventory levels to in Miami and other developing North American hubs with more than $50 million worth of parts. A.J. Walter also signed a three year consignment agreement with StandardAero.

GE Aviation signed a 15-year, $360 million OnPoint material agreement with SkyWest airlines to support the carrier's 150 CF34-8C5B1 engines, which power Bombardier CRJ700 aircraft.

AAR won a 10-year, cost-per-flight-hour contract from Alaska Airlines to provide component repair and management services for its fleet of 87 Boeing 737-700, 800 and 900 aircraft. AAR's aviation supply chain group will manage the program for high-removal, high-value components.
